a kind of critique that looks into the origin of ancient texts in order to fully understand "the world

beyond the text."

Historical approach, is a literary criticism focused on historical facts or the context in which a work was
written.

Historical critism has also been applied to other religious and secular writings from various parts of the
world.

Reader-response criticism is a literary theory school that reflects on the reader (or "audience") and their
engagement with the work.

Reader-response theory is based on the assumption that a literary work takes place in the
mutual relationship between the reader and the text.

Reader-response criticism argues that literature should be viewed as a performing art in which each
reader creates their own, possibly unique, text-related performance.
